KidBiz Camp is a fun and interactive program that helps kids aged 13 to 18 learn about starting and running a business. Over eight weeks, kids will take part in activities, workshops, and meet with mentors to learn about creativity, business planning, handling money, marketing, and good business practices. The camp ends with a community event where kids present their business ideas to local business people, parents, and friends. Each week focuses on a different topic, like what entrepreneurship is, how to come up with and test business ideas, creating business plans, managing money, marketing, and presenting ideas. Kids will hear from guest speakers, work on projects, and get guidance from mentors to help them learn and grow. KidBiz Camp aims to be a welcoming place for all kids, no matter their background, to explore and develop their business skills.
